大数据分析师的主要工作包括:数据收集、数据清洗、数据存储、数据分析、数据可视化和数据解读。其中,数据分析是最关键的一环,因为它直接决定了数据驱动决策的有效性。大数据分析师通过使用各种统计方法和机器学习算法,对大量复杂的数据进行深入分析,从而发现潜在的商业机会、优化业务流程以及预测未来趋势。这不仅需要扎实的技术功底,还需要对行业有深入的理解,以便能够将技术成果转化为有价值的商业洞见。
一、数据收集
大数据分析师首先需要从各种来源收集数据,这些来源可以是内部系统(如ERP、CRM等)、外部API(如社交媒体、市场调研数据等),甚至是开放数据集。数据收集的过程包括确定数据源、建立数据连接、编写数据抓取脚本和自动化数据收集流程。数据收集的质量直接影响后续分析的准确性,因此大数据分析师必须确保数据的完整性和准确性。
在数据收集过程中,大数据分析师需要了解数据的格式和结构,以便后续处理。例如,某些数据可能是非结构化的,如文本数据和图像数据,需要使用自然语言处理(NLP)和计算机视觉技术进行处理。对于结构化数据,分析师需要熟悉SQL等查询语言,以便高效地提取数据。
二、数据清洗
数据清洗是大数据分析师的另一项重要任务。数据清洗的目的是去除数据中的噪音和错误,提高数据的质量。这一过程通常包括处理缺失值、去除重复数据、纠正数据格式、识别和修复异常值等。数据清洗不仅需要技术手段,还需要一定的业务知识,以判断哪些数据是合理的,哪些需要修正。
例如,在处理客户数据时,可能会遇到客户的联系方式缺失或格式不正确的情况。这时,分析师需要使用一定的规则和算法进行自动化处理,或者与业务部门沟通,确定合理的修正方法。数据清洗的结果直接影响到数据分析的准确性和可靠性,因此这一过程至关重要。
三、数据存储
在数据收集和清洗之后,数据需要被存储在适当的数据库或数据仓库中。大数据分析师需要了解各种数据存储技术,如关系型数据库(MySQL、PostgreSQL)、NoSQL数据库(MongoDB、Cassandra)、分布式存储系统(Hadoop HDFS)等,以选择最适合的数据存储方案。数据存储的效率和安全性是分析工作顺利进行的基础。
数据存储不仅仅是简单的保存数据,还包括数据的组织和管理。例如,分析师需要设计合理的数据库表结构、建立索引以提高查询效率、设置数据备份和恢复策略以保障数据安全等。对于大规模数据,分析师还需要考虑数据分区和分片,以便高效处理和分析。
四、数据分析
数据分析是大数据分析师工作的核心。数据分析的目标是通过对数据的深入研究,发现隐藏在数据背后的规律和趋势。这一过程通常包括数据探索性分析(EDA)、统计分析、机器学习模型训练和评估等。大数据分析师需要熟练掌握各种数据分析工具和编程语言,如Python、R、SAS等。
在数据分析过程中,分析师需要根据具体的业务需求选择合适的分析方法。例如,对于时间序列数据,可以使用ARIMA模型进行预测;对于分类问题,可以使用决策树、随机森林等机器学习算法。数据分析的结果需要经过严格的验证和评估,以确保其准确性和可靠性。
五、数据可视化
数据可视化是将复杂的数据分析结果以直观的图形和图表形式展示出来,以便非技术人员也能理解和应用。数据可视化的目的是帮助决策者快速掌握数据的核心信息。大数据分析师需要熟练使用各种可视化工具,如Tableau、Power BI、D3.js等。
在数据可视化过程中,分析师需要选择合适的图表类型,如柱状图、折线图、散点图、热力图等,以便清晰地展示数据的特征和趋势。数据可视化不仅仅是简单的图表绘制,还包括数据的交互和动态展示,以便用户能够深入探索数据。例如,可以使用仪表盘(Dashboard)展示关键指标,使用交互式图表展示数据的多维度分析。
六、数据解读
数据解读是将数据分析和可视化的结果转化为具体的业务洞见和建议。数据解读的关键是将技术语言转化为业务语言,以便决策者能够理解和应用。大数据分析师需要具备良好的沟通能力和业务理解能力,以便能够有效地传达分析结果。
在数据解读过程中,分析师需要结合具体的业务场景,解释数据的意义和影响。例如,在市场营销分析中,分析师需要解释客户行为数据的变化趋势,以及这些变化对营销策略的影响。数据解读不仅仅是简单的结果描述,还包括对数据背后原因的深入分析和解释,以便决策者能够做出明智的决策。
七、数据驱动的决策支持
大数据分析师的最终目标是支持数据驱动的决策。数据驱动的决策是基于数据分析结果,而不是直觉和经验。分析师需要提供可靠的数据支持,帮助决策者在复杂的业务环境中做出科学的决策。
例如,在供应链管理中,分析师可以通过数据分析,发现供应链中的瓶颈和优化机会,从而提出改进建议;在金融行业,分析师可以通过数据分析,发现潜在的风险和投资机会,从而支持投资决策。数据驱动的决策不仅提高了决策的准确性和效率,还能够帮助企业在竞争中获得优势。
八、持续学习和技术更新
大数据分析是一个快速发展的领域,技术和工具不断更新。持续学习和技术更新是大数据分析师保持竞争力的关键。分析师需要不断学习新的数据分析方法、工具和技术,以便能够应对不断变化的业务需求和技术挑战。
例如,近年来,深度学习和人工智能技术在大数据分析中的应用越来越广泛,分析师需要学习和掌握这些新技术,以便能够在实际项目中应用。持续学习不仅仅是技术知识的更新,还包括业务知识的更新,以便能够更好地理解和解决实际业务问题。
大数据分析师的工作涉及数据的各个方面,从数据收集、清洗、存储,到数据分析、可视化和解读,再到数据驱动的决策支持和持续学习。每一个环节都需要专业的技能和深入的业务理解,只有这样,才能发挥大数据的真正价值,帮助企业实现数据驱动的业务转型和创新。
相关问答FAQs:
大数据分析师都做什么?
-
收集和清洗数据:大数据分析师的工作首先是收集各种来源的数据,包括结构化数据(如数据库)和非结构化数据(如社交媒体数据),然后对数据进行清洗,确保数据质量以便后续分析使用。
-
数据分析和建模:大数据分析师使用各种数据分析工具和技术,如Python、R、SQL等,对数据进行分析和建模,以发现数据背后的模式、趋势和洞见。他们可能会应用统计学、机器学习和数据挖掘等技术来进行深入分析。
-
制定数据驱动的决策:大数据分析师将分析结果转化为可理解和可操作的见解,并为企业或组织提供数据驱动的决策支持。他们可能会撰写报告、制作可视化图表,向管理层或决策者传达数据分析的重要发现。
-
优化业务流程:通过数据分析,大数据分析师可以帮助企业发现业务流程中的瓶颈和改进机会,从而优化业务流程,提高效率和降低成本。
-
预测未来趋势:利用历史数据和趋势,大数据分析师可以进行预测分析,帮助企业预测未来市场走势、客户行为等,为未来的决策提供参考依据。
-
数据安全和隐私保护:大数据分析师在处理大量数据时,需要保证数据的安全性和隐私性,遵守相关法规和政策,确保数据不被非法获取或泄露。
-
持续学习和技术更新:由于数据分析领域技术更新迭代较快,大数据分析师需要不断学习新的技术和工具,保持自身竞争力和专业能力。他们可能参加培训课程、研讨会,或自主学习新技能。
-
与团队合作:大数据分析师通常需要与其他部门或团队合作,共同解决复杂的数据问题,因此良好的沟通和团队合作能力是他们工作中必不可少的技能之一。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。如有任何问题或意见,您可以通过联系market@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。